Output e0456c92652bcb5e6d6c3da4d6fd1aa20b8efdd0e94ecfbae4e2e9e43dd77008:0

value
2658162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0ea509186ce33605c179fadf82f1a22891f1b5d OP_EQUAL
address
3LjfAv7yCeeHScJLJY7feYTiYjiyJuGuV6
transaction
e0456c92652bcb5e6d6c3da4d6fd1aa20b8efdd0e94ecfbae4e2e9e43dd77008
spent
true